EDWARD H. BREESE AND OTHER STERLING SILVER SALT AND PEPPER SHAKERS, LOT OF 29,
including a tall pair by Edward H. Breese of Chicago, IL, a tall pair by Richard Dimes of South Boston, MA with engraved "V.W.L." initials, a medium-sized pair by Lenox Silver Inc. of New York City, NY, and a set of five small shakers by G.H. French & Co. of North Attleboro, MA. Each marked for sterling fineness, some with maker's marks. Total weight: 17.455 ozt.
20th century.
Breese shakers 5 1/4" HOA.
Provenance: Property from a Youngstown, OH estate.
Condition
Most in good to very good overall condition with some wear, surface scratches, and other imperfections including bending, nicks, dents, and/or remnants/oxidation to interiors; one Richard Dimes shaker with significant dents to base at stem, two small shakers with frozen caps.
